Analysis

In 2023, merchandise exports to high-income economies in Luxembourg stood at 91.4%.

That represents a change of down 0.9% on the previous year and down 1.7% over ten years.

Over the whole period, merchandise exports to high-income economies in Luxembourg peaked at 97.1% in 2002 and was at its lowest, 91.1%, in 2012.

Luxembourg ranks 16th of 206 countries on this measure, in the top 10%.

The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 27 years of available data.

Merchandise exports to high-income economies are the sum of merchandise exports from the reporting economy to high-income economies according to the World Bank classification of economies. Data are expressed as a percentage of total merchandise exports by the economy. Data are computed only if at least half of the economies in the partner country group had non-missing data.
